Definition and Scope of Remote Deposit Capture

Remote Deposit Capture (RDC) refers to software solutions and services that allow financial institutions and enterprises to process check deposits remotely without visiting bank branches. The market includes both on-premise and cloud-based deployment models, serving large enterprises as well as small and medium enterprises (SMEs). RDC is widely applied across branch deposits, retail deposits, commercial deposits, and back-office operations, providing a scalable and efficient mechanism for cash flow management and transaction processing.

Market Drivers

Digital Transformation in Banking: Increasing focus on digital banking and contactless transactions is boosting the adoption of RDC solutions across North American banks and financial institutions.

Operational Efficiency and Cost Reduction: RDC helps reduce manual check handling, accelerates deposit processing, and lowers operational expenses, making it a preferred solution for enterprises of all sizes.

Rising Demand for Remote Banking Solutions: The growing preference for mobile and online banking, supported by technological advancements and changing customer expectations, is fueling market growth.

Regulatory Support for Electronic Transactions: Government and banking regulations encouraging secure, electronic banking transactions are promoting wider adoption of RDC solutions.

Market Restraints

Security and Fraud Concerns: Potential risks related to check fraud, data breaches, and cyber threats may limit adoption, especially among smaller institutions.

Integration Challenges with Legacy Systems: Banks using outdated IT infrastructure may face difficulties integrating RDC solutions, hindering deployment speed.

High Implementation Costs: Initial investment in software, hardware, and maintenance—particularly for on-premise deployments—can be a barrier for SMEs or smaller banks.

Opportunities

Cloud-Based RDC Solutions: Cloud deployments offer scalability, reduced maintenance costs, and simplified integration, driving adoption among banks and enterprises.

Expansion in Commercial and Retail Banking Sectors: Increased use of RDC for commercial deposits, retail banking, and back-office operations presents growth opportunities for service providers.

Integration with Mobile and AI Technologies: Incorporating mobile capture, AI-based fraud detection, and automated processing enhances the efficiency and security of RDC systems.

Rising Adoption by SMEs: Small and medium enterprises are increasingly leveraging RDC to streamline cash management and reduce dependency on branch visits, providing a significant market opportunity.
